Norwich council adopts cybersecurity match and ARPA amendment; manager reports on $10.6M bond sale
Summary
The council unanimously approved a local match for a state/local cybersecurity grant for the finance department and adopted an amendment to American Rescue Plan Act allocations; the city manager also reported a successful $10.6 million bond sale and tax-sale recoveries.
Norwich City Council unanimously adopted two resolutions on Dec. 16, 2024: acceptance of a local match for a state and local cybersecurity grant for the Norwich Finance Department, and an amendment to existing American Rescue Plan Act (ARPA) allocations. Both measures passed by 6–0 votes.
